The Complete Beethoven Quartets VI

Beethoven’s string quartets performed by Cuarteto Casals

At Klarafestival 2020, the renowned Catalan string quartet Cuarteto Casals performs a titanic six-concert series of the complete Beethoven quartets, accompanied by six commissioned works from composers of its generation.
 
Beethoven’s first six string quartets, commissioned by Prince Lobkowitz, demonstrate his total mastery of the classic string quartet as developed by Haydn and Mozart. His Fourth String Quartet is thought to be in part based on earlier material, due to its Sturm und Drang characteristics.
 
Five years after having finished his first set of string quartets, Beethoven was commissioned by the Russian ambassador to Vienna Andrey Razumovsky to write three new string quartets. Beethoven’s Ninth String Quartet is the last of the so-called Razumovsky Quartets and was in Beethoven’s time the most popular one.
 
Beethoven considered the Fourteenth String Quartet his best work. This seven-part composition, to be performed without any interruptions, expresses a wide range of conflicting emotions: from intimate meditations to explosive eruptions. After hearing this string quartet five days before his death, Schubert remarked: “after this, what is left for us to write?”. This composition was also a source of light for the Spanish composer and conductor Mauricio Sotelo, who based his piece Quasals-vB-131 upon it. The title of this composition for string quartet is a combination of ‘Quasar’ (a quasi-stellar object: an active galactic nucleus of very high luminosity), Cuarteto Casals and the opus number (131) of Beethoven’s Fourteenth String Quartet.
